用同体系模型动态比浊法定量测定血液透析浓缩液的细菌内毒素 被引量:8

The application of the homologous system model in determining the concentrated solution of hemodialysis—quantitative endotoxin assay

摘要 目的 授权应用已获专利的能有效消除供试品干扰的定量内毒素检查方法——同体系模型(专利号:03126794.7)动态比浊法定量检查血液透析酸性浓缩液(A液)中的细菌内毒素含量。方法 对A液中定量添加标准内毒素进行干扰预试验,将A液稀释成30,40,50,60倍,定量添加标准内毒素,其回收率分别为76.12%。112.4%,173.6%,141.8%;从中筛选出最佳的稀释倍数为40倍,对3个批号(GH0504003,GH0504009,GH0504012)A液进行干扰试验,其回收率分别为116.7%,90.42%,113.8%。结果 标准内毒素使用0.0156,0.125,1.00Eu/mL,将A液稀释成40倍,定量添加标准内毒素,回收率均在50%~200%之间,认为A液对动态比浊法无干扰作用。可用于A液供试品检查。结论 应用同体系模型动态比浊法可以定量检测A液中的细菌内毒素。 Purpose To apply the homologous system model (having got the patent) in determining the concentrated solution of hemodialysis ( A solution). Methods The interference test was fulfilled in A solution, which was diluted to 1/30,1/40,1/50,1/60, and the rates of recovery were and 76.12 %, 112.4 %, 173.6 % and 141.8 % respectively, but when the amount of endotoxin was addedto sample ( GH0504003, GH0504009, GH0504012) diluted to 1/40, the rates of recovery were 116.7%, 90.42% and 13.8% respectively. Results A solution diluted to 1/40 was added to the endotoxin standard and the concentrations in working curve were 0.015 6,0. 125 and, 1.00 Eu/mL. It is considered that the A solution was effective to eliminate the interference on turbidimetric method. Conclusion The kinetic turbidimetric method for homologous system model provides a new way to the detection of endotoxin in the concentrated solution of hemodialysis.
